A grinning Mata didn't exactly look like he was on the brink of chinning his manager, did he?
Many fans took exception with the use of the word 'restrained', pointing out that the diminutive Spaniard was a picture of calm in the moments that followed the full-time whistle.
https://twitter.com/Gav246/status/762347467832750080
https://twitter.com/DeadIyRonaldo/status/762344294401380352
In fairness, Luckhurst did extend on his tweet a few minutes later on.
'When I say 'restrained', I don't mean he was going to deck him, he explained. 'Staff tried to get him to sit down.'
As for Mourinho, he also explained why he'd taken the unusual step of substituting a substitute when speaking to BT Sport after the game.
"I needed to take the smallest player off. Because I knew they were going to play big," said Mourinho.
"So I can't remove the tall ones."
